The Duty of the Thermostat in Heating And Cooling Performance

Commonly neglected, the thermostat plays a crucial duty in the performance of Heating and cooling systems. This little tool functions as the main control center, managing temperature settings and making sure ideal comfort within a room. By precisely sensing the ambient temperature level, the thermostat communicates with the air, ventilation, and home heating conditioning systems to maintain the wanted climate
An efficient thermostat reduces energy intake by activating the HVAC system only when essential, consequently avoiding too much heating or cooling. Modern wise and programmable thermostats enhance this performance additionally by allowing individuals to set routines and remotely change settings, adapting to day-to-day regimens.
The placement of the thermostat is necessary; improper place can lead to unreliable temperature level readings, resulting in ineffective procedure. On the whole, a well-functioning thermostat not just boosts comfort however additionally contributes considerably to power financial savings and the longevity of the heating and cooling system.
Comprehending the Significance of Air Filters
Air filters offer a vital feature in a/c systems by ensuring that the air circulating within a space remains clean and healthy. These filters catch dust, irritants, and other pollutants, stopping them from being recirculated throughout the environment. By catching these bits, air filters add to enhanced interior air quality, which can significantly profit occupants' health and wellness, particularly those with allergies or respiratory conditions.
Furthermore, maintaining tidy air filters improves the effectiveness of a/c systems. Clogged up filters can restrict air movement, causing the system to work more challenging to keep desired temperatures, resulting in raised power usage and greater energy bills. On a regular basis replacing or cleaning up filters is a vital maintenance action that can lengthen the lifespan of cooling and heating devices. Inevitably, understanding the relevance of air filters enables house owners and building supervisors to take proactive procedures to assure a well-functioning, effective heating and cooling system that promotes a secure and comfy interior environment.

The Performance of the Heating System and Heatpump
Furnaces and warm pumps are important parts of cooling and heating systems, in charge of providing warmth during chillier months. Furnaces run by home heating air via combustion or electric resistance, after that dispersing it throughout the home using air ducts. They generally supply fast heating and can be fueled by all-natural gas, electrical power, or oil, relying on the system type.
Conversely, heatpump transfer heat instead of generate it. They draw out warmth from the outdoors air or ground, also in reduced temperature levels, and move it indoors. HVAC experts. This twin capability permits heatpump to likewise supply air conditioning in warmer months, making them functional choices for year-round environment control
Both systems call for appropriate upkeep to guarantee effectiveness and longevity. While heating systems master severe chilly, heatpump can be advantageous in moderate climates. Recognizing their distinctive functionalities aids property owners in picking one of the most ideal option for their home heating needs.

Sorts Of Air Conditioners
While numerous elements affect the choice of cooling systems, understanding the various types offered is essential for home owners and building managers alike. Central air conditioning conditioners are created to cool down entire homes or structures, utilizing a network of ducts for airflow. Window systems provide an even more local option, perfect for small rooms or single areas. Mobile ac system give adaptability, permitting individuals to move the system as needed. Ductless mini-split systems are another alternative, integrating the performance of central systems with the convenience of zoning, as they call for no ductwork. Lastly, geothermal systems harness the planet's temperature for energy-efficient cooling. Each type includes distinctive advantages, making informed selections crucial for reliable climate control.

Effectiveness Ratings Discussed
Comprehending effectiveness scores is important for picking the best air conditioning unit, as these metrics give insight into the system's performance and power usage. One of the most typical rating for air conditioners is the Seasonal Energy Effectiveness Ratio (SEER), which determines the cooling output throughout a normal air conditioning period separated by the total electric power input. A higher SEER shows much better effectiveness. In addition, the Energy Effectiveness Ratio (EER) is used for gauging efficiency under particular conditions. One more essential metric is the Power Celebrity certification, which indicates that a device meets stringent power effectiveness standards. By assessing these scores, customers can make informed choices that not just optimize comfort however additionally decrease power prices and ecological impact.
The Relevance of Ductwork and Air flow
Effective ductwork style and air movement administration play crucial roles in the general performance and performance of HVAC systems. Appropriate ductwork warranties that conditioned air is distributed evenly throughout an area, lessening temperature level fluctuations and enhancing comfort. Properly designed air ducts reduce resistance to air movement, decreasing the workload on cooling and heating equipment and ultimately reducing energy intake.
Airflow administration includes tactically putting vents and registers to improve the flow of air. This stops typical problems such as hot or chilly spots, which can happen when air flow is blocked or inadequately balanced. Furthermore, the appropriate air duct materials and insulation can additionally improve effectiveness by decreasing warmth loss or gain throughout air transit.
A reliable ductwork system not just adds to energy financial savings however can likewise prolong the lifespan of HVAC equipment by reducing unneeded pressure (HVAC experts). As a result, understanding the significance of ductwork and air flow is important for accomplishing peak heating and cooling system efficiency
Regular Upkeep Practices to Improve Efficiency
Routine upkeep methods are important for ensuring peak efficiency of heating and cooling systems. These techniques consist of regular assessments, cleansing, and needed fixings to maintain the system running efficiently. On a regular basis changing air filters is important, as clogged filters can block air movement and reduce efficiency. Additionally, professionals ought to examine and clean evaporator and condenser coils to avoid overheating and energy wastage.
Yearly expert inspections are additionally recommended, as trained professionals can determine possible concerns before they escalate. Lubing relocating parts reduces damage, adding to a much longer life-span for the system. Making sure that the thermostat works correctly help in maintaining ideal temperature control.
Regularly Asked Concerns
How Commonly Should I Change My Thermostat?
Thermostats ought to generally be replaced every 5 to 10 years, depending upon usage and modern technology advancements. Normal checks are recommended to guarantee peak performance, particularly if experiencing irregular temperature level control or enhanced energy expenses.
What Dimension Air Filter Is Finest for My Cooling And Heating System?
The very best size air filter for a cooling and heating system varies by system style. Usually, it's vital to speak with the owner's handbook or inspect the existing filter dimensions to assure peak efficiency and air quality.
Can I Install a Heatpump Myself?
Installing a warmth pump individually is feasible for skilled individuals, but it requires expertise of local codes and electrical read more systems. Working with a specialist is advised to guarantee correct installment and ideal system efficiency.
Just how Do I Know if My Ductwork Is Efficient?
To identify ductwork effectiveness, one should check for leaks, step air movement at vents, inspect insulation quality, and examine temperature level differences in between supply and return air ducts. Expert assessments can provide detailed understandings into general efficiency.
What Are Indications My Heating And Cooling Requirements Immediate Maintenance?
Indicators that a HVAC system requires prompt upkeep include uncommon sounds, irregular temperature levels, raised energy costs, unpleasant smells, and regular cycling. Addressing these concerns without delay can stop more damage and warranty peak system performance.
